Online platforms expert witnesses and testimony consultants note that as digital, mobile, social and Internet services take on an increasingly central position in commerce, communication, and content distribution, legal disputes involving providers are becoming more frequent and demanding. In such cases, the best online platforms expert witnesses provide perspectives into how these systems work, how users interact with them, and whether the providers acted lawfully and fairly. Attorneys may rely on varying sorts of consultants, each with a specific area of focus.
1. Social Media Platform Experts
Top online platforms expert witnesses here look at social networks like Facebook, Instagram, X (formerly Twitter), TikTok, and LinkedIn. Reviewers analyze how posts are shared, how content is moderated, and whether platform policies were properly enforced. SMEs get brought in for cases involving defamation, harassment, banned accounts, or algorithmic bias.
2. E-Commerce Platform Experts
As online platforms expert witnesses, focus on online marketplaces such as Amazon, eBay, Shopify, or Etsy. Examine disputes involving seller bans, product removals, false reviews, counterfeit goods, or violations of marketplace rules and third-party agreements.
3. Content Moderation Experts
Typically with backgrounds in trust and safety or Internet policy, online platforms expert witnesses analyze how services enforce community guidelines. Reviewers evaluate if content removals, account suspensions, or demonetizations were consistent, fair, and aligned with stated policies.
4. Search and Discovery Algorithm Experts
Leading online platforms expert witnesses explain how recommendation engines and search algorithms affect content visibility. Folks are useful in cases where visibility or reach (or the lack of it) is central—such as shadow banning, demonetization, or platform favoritism.
5. Data Privacy and User Tracking Experts
In cases involving data misuse, consent violations, or breaches of privacy laws (such as GDPR or CCPA), these experts analyze how platforms collect, store, and share user data.
6. Digital Advertising Experts
Noted online platforms expert witnesses consider how advertising functions on platforms like Google Ads, Facebook Ads, or YouTube monetization. KOLs provide insight into click fraud, ad placement disputes, and revenue calculations.
7. Platform Liability and Section 230 Experts
Analyze whether a platform is legally responsible for user-generated content and explain the scope of legal protections under Section 230 or similar laws.
